2005 BMW 330 vs. 2005 Mahindra Bolero
To start off, both 2005 BMW 330 and 2005 Mahindra Bolero were released in the same year (2005).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 2,979 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 BMW 330 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 BMW 330 (229 HP @ 5900 RPM) has 157 more horse power than 2005 Mahindra Bolero. (72 HP @ 4000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 BMW 330 should accelerate faster than 2005 Mahindra Bolero.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Mahindra Bolero weights approximately 193 kg more than 2005 BMW 330.
Because 2005 Mahindra Bolero is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 BMW 330.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Mahindra Bolero will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 BMW 330 (300 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 145 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Mahindra Bolero. (155 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 2005 BMW 330 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Mahindra Bolero.
